Fisher House joins Invictus Games Düsseldorf 2023 as premiere partner

Fisher House Foundation has been announced as a Premier Partner of the INVICTUS GAMES DÜSSELDORF 2023.

As a long-term supporter of the Invictus Games Foundation, the charity that oversees the Invictus Games, Fisher House Foundation has been the only Premier Partner present for every event since the inaugural Invictus Games London 2014.

“We have been honored to partner with the Invictus Games for the past ten years and are excited for the Invictus Games Düsseldorf 2023,” said Fisher House Foundation Chairman and CEO Ken Fisher. “Germany is an important location for our military community, which is why we have two Fisher Houses at the Landstuhl Regional Medical Center. Many of our Iraq and Afghanistan veterans and allies received critical treatment before they were stable enough to return to the United States, and many more service members and their families have called Germany home while being stationed there, making this location very special,” Fisher continued.

Fisher House Foundation is an international non-profit organization established to improve the quality of life for military personnel, veterans, and their families. For more than 30 years, the Fisher House program has provided comfortable housing for families of patients receiving medical care at major military and Veterans Affairs (VA) medical centers. In these accommodations, families of active and former military personnel can stay free of charge to be near their loved ones during medical treatment. To date, there are 94 Fisher Houses located in the U.S., Germany, and the U.K.

FISHER HOUSE FOUNDATION ENABLES FAMILY & FRIENDS PROGRAMM

Fisher House Foundation will continue to sponsor the Invictus Games Family & Friends Program in 2023, which it helped create in 2014. The program enables competitors from all participating nations to bring two family members or friends to the Games, accompanying them during this important step on the road to rehabilitation. Family & Friends are an integral part of the recovery journey supported by the Invictus Games. In recognition of their having walked the path back to a self-determined life together with the competitors, they experience respect and recognition at the Games, enjoy a carefree time, and take away positive memories. Thanks to the program, Family & Friends are not only able to experience the sporting events with the competitors, they can also explore the city of Düsseldorf with them as part of a cultural and excursion program. Further benefits will include free travel and accommodation on site, free use of public transport, and meals during the Games.

“Family & Friends are an integral and indispensable part of every Invictus Games. They are the very foundation on which the rehabilitation of the competitors rests. We are very pleased that, thanks to the commitment of the Fisher House Foundation, we will be able to welcome Family & Friends from all over the world to the Games in 2023 as well, showing them the respect and recognition they deserve,” says Brigadier General Alfred Marstaller, CEO of the INVICTUS GAMES DÜSSELDORF 2023.

INTERNATIONAL SPORTS EVENT UNDER THE BANNER OF RECOVERY AND REHABILITATION

This year, the sixth Invictus Games will take place September 9-16 in Düsseldorf, Germany for the first time. More than 500 wounded, injured and sick service personnel and veterans from 22 nations will take part in 10 sports. What counts is not elite performance but competition, people, team spirit and the will to live. Through sport, the competitors draw strength for their recovery and rehabilitation. Their sporting achievements show their progress in their recovery and their will to find their way back into life after serious injuries or illnesses.

ABOUT FISHER HOUSE FOUNDATION

Fisher House Foundation is best known for its network of nearly 100 comfort homes where military and veteran families can stay at no cost while a loved one is receiving treatment. These homes are located at major military and VA medical facilities nationwide and in Europe, close to the medical facility they serve. Fisher Houses have up to 21 suites with private bedrooms and baths. Families share a common kitchen, laundry facilities, a warm dining room and an inviting living room. Fisher House Foundation ensures that there is never a lodging fee. Since inception, the program has saved military and veteran families an estimated $575 million in out-of-pocket costs for lodging and transportation.
